Suggested Procedure:

A – Changing from Reversed Phase to Normal Phase HPLC; pump 100% methanol for 15 minutes at 1 mL / minute flow rate, followed by 15 minutes 100% methylene chloride. The column is ready to be equilibrated with mobile phase for NP HPLC.

B – Changing from Normal Phase to Reverses Phase HPLC; pump 100% methylene chloride for 15 minutes at 1 mL / minute flow rate, followed by 15 minutes 100% methanol. The column is ready to be equilibrated with mobile phase for RP-HPLC.

A simple 30 minute procedure allows switching from one mode to another.
